I don’t like telling people „bimax will do stuff for you“ or not.

I say morph yourself and see if you can achieve good results with realistic movements.

It’s hard to guess if someone could look better. I think we need to see and then decide if the changes are worth the effort.

The upper jaw surgery WILL affect your nose width. The alarbase WILL become wider. Many patients need further surgery’s to combat nose. Or the cheekbones look to far behind compared to the now projected maxilla and so on.


There is a good thread someone recently made. Especially in terms of bimax it’s a Risk vs reward. No surgery has no complications. And if you’re lucky it’s 1/50 that everything goes as planned.

If you aren’t sure you will benefit from bimax even with complications happening then it’s not worth the functional and aesthetic risks. In my opinion.


For me. I expect complications and am still willing to do it.
